Jim
Barclay, a Seventh-day Adventist layman from the Illinois Conference, was
looking for a soul-winning method that could employ hundreds of thousands of
lay-people across the United States. As he prayed, God inspired him with the
idea of taking the gospel to the masses through the bulk-mailing of gospel
literature. Thus PROJECT: Steps to Christ was born. Jim and his wife, Connie,
directed the project from 1976 until 1992, when Jim fell asleep in Jesus.
